One of Canada’s top rising prospects, Jasmine Jasudavicius has her next UFC assignment.

At a UFC Fight Night event scheduled for June 18, Jasudavicius (7-1 MMA, 0-0 UFC) returns for her second promotional outing when she battles Brazilian debutant Natalia Silva (12-5-1 MMA, 0-0 UFC), pending bout finalization. The three-round bout takes place at 125 pounds.

A person with knowledge of the matchup recently informed MMA Junkie of the targeted booking but asked to remain anonymous as the promotion has yet to make an official announcement. Combate was first to report the bout Tuesday.

Jasudavicius, 33, won her promotional debut in January when she defeated Kay Hansen via unanimous decision at UFC 270. The victory came after Jasudavicius earned a promotional contract on Dana White’s Contender Series.

Silva, 25, has been on the UFC roster since 2020 but has yet to fight. She was expected to fight Victoria Leonardo in January 2021, but after her withdrawal from the bout was not rebooked until now.
